When a standing patient lowers their gluteal muscles towards the floor (performing a squat - like motion), at the knee, the femur rolls posteriorly as it slides anteriorly to maintain joint congruence and proper movement mechanics. This is due to the anatomy and kinematics of the knee joint.

Answer:

c) Femur rolls posterior as it slides anterior
